What to Look for in a Rugged Tablet for Video Editing

Video editing is a resource-intensive task. It requires a good balance of processing power, memory, and fast storage. When choosing a rugged tablet for this purpose, here are the key features to prioritize:
1. Powerful Processor (CPU)
This is the brain of your tablet. For video editing, you need a processor that can handle complex tasks like rendering, encoding, and playback smoothly.
Intel Core Processors: Look for Intel Core i5, i7, or even i9 processors (if available in a rugged model). These are common in more powerful rugged devices and offer excellent performance.
AMD Processors: Some rugged tablets might feature AMD Ryzen processors, which are also strong contenders for creative workloads.
ARM-Based Processors: While increasingly powerful (like Apple’s M-series or certain Snapdragon chips), they are less common in highly ruggedized devices designed for industrial use, though some adventure-focused rugged tablets might feature them. When comparing ARM, focus on chip generation and core counts.
2. Ample RAM (Memory)
RAM is crucial for multitasking and smooth operation when editing. Video editing software and large video files consume a lot of memory.
Minimum: Aim for at least 16GB of RAM.
Recommended: 32GB or more will provide a significantly smoother experience, especially for 4K footage or complex edits.
3. Fast and Sufficient Storage (SSD)
Video files are large, and editing them requires quick access to those files. Solid State Drives (SSDs) are essential for speed.
Type: Always opt for an SSD. Avoid older Hard Disk Drives (HDDs) if video editing is a primary use case.
Capacity: You’ll need substantial storage.
Minimum: 512GB SSD.
Recommended: 1TB SSD or more.
Expandability: Look for tablets with microSD card slots or USB-C ports for external storage solutions, as onboard storage can fill up quickly.
4. Display Quality
While rugged tablets might not always boast the vibrant OLED screens of consumer tablets, a good display is still important for color accuracy and detail.
Resolution: Full HD (1920 x 1080) is a minimum. Higher resolutions like 2K or 4K are beneficial for seeing finer details.
Brightness: A brighter display (measured in nits) is essential for outdoor use and better visibility in various lighting conditions.
Size: A larger screen (10 inches or more) will make editing more comfortable.
5. Graphics Processing Unit (GPU)
While many rugged tablets rely on integrated graphics within the CPU, some higher-end models might have dedicated GPUs. A dedicated GPU can significantly speed up rendering and playback for more demanding video projects.
6. Connectivity
USB Ports: Multiple USB-A and USB-C ports are invaluable for connecting external drives, card readers, and other peripherals. USB 3.0 or higher is preferred for speed.
Wi-Fi and Cellular: Strong Wi-Fi is a must. If you need to upload or download footage from cloud storage in the field, robust LTE or 5G connectivity is a huge plus.
SD Card Reader: A built-in SD card reader can save you from carrying extra adapters.
7. Battery Life
Video editing is a battery drain. Look for tablets with large battery capacities or hot-swappable batteries if continuous operation is required.
8. Software Compatibility
Ensure the tablet runs an operating system that supports your preferred video editing software.
Windows: Offers the widest compatibility with professional editing suites like Adobe Premiere Pro, DaVinci Resolve, and Final Cut Pro (though the latter is Mac-only, so this would be for Windows alternatives from Blackmagic Design).
Android: While it has mobile-focused editing apps (like KineMaster or PowerDirector), it’s less common for professional workflows. However, some powerful Android tablets can handle lighter editing tasks adequately.
Proven Rugged Tablets for Video Editing: Our Top Picks

Finding rugged tablets that are specifically marketed for video editing is rare. The performance comes from robust, business-class or industrial-grade devices that happen to have the horsepower. Here’s a look at some brands and models that often fit the bill, keeping in mind that exact specifications and availability can vary.
Panasonic Toughbook Series
Panasonic’s Toughbook line is synonymous with ruggedness. While many are designed for fieldwork in harsh conditions, some models offer desktop-grade performance.
Panasonic Toughbook 40: This is a flagship device designed for extreme environments. It features a 14-inch rugged display and can be configured with powerful Intel Core processors (up to i7), ample RAM (up to 64GB), and fast SSD storage up to 1TB. Its modular design even allows for specialized attachments, though this isn’t directly for editing performance, it speaks to its versatility. The 40 is built to withstand drops, dust, water, and extreme temperatures.
Pros: Unparalleled durability; high-end configurable specs; excellent for extreme environments; large, bright screen.
Cons: Very expensive; bulky; repairability can be a concern.
Panasonic Toughbook G2: A 2-in-1 rugged device that offers a good blend of tablet and laptop functionality. It can be configured with Intel Core i5 or i7 processors, up to 32GB RAM, and 1TB SSD. Its smaller form factor (10.1-inch screen) makes it more portable than the 40 but still offers robust protection.
Pros: Good balance of power and portability; very rugged; versatile 2-in-1 design.
Cons: Screen size might be limiting for detailed editing; still a premium price point.
Getac Tablets
Getac is another leader in rugged computing, offering a range of devices built for demanding professions.
Getac UX10: This 10.1-inch fully rugged tablet can be configured with powerful Intel Core processors (i5/i7), up to 32GB of RAM, and 1TB SSD storage. It’s designed to operate in extreme temperatures, resist drops, and handle dust and water ingress. Its ergonomic handle and optional keyboard make it flexible for various tasks.
Pros: Very durable; good performance options; relatively portable for a rugged tablet.
Cons: Can be costly; screen might not be as color-accurate as some non-rugged professional tablets.
Getac F110: A larger 11.6-inch rugged tablet that bridges the gap between a tablet and a small laptop. It offers even more configuration options for performance, including powerful Intel processors, significant RAM, and large SSDs. Its larger screen is more conducive to editing.
Pros: Larger display for editing; excellent ruggedness; powerful configurations available.
Cons: Heavier and bulkier than smaller tablets; enterprise-focused pricing.
Samsung Galaxy Tab Active Series
While not as “military-grade” as Panasonic or Getac, Samsung’s Galaxy Tab Active line offers a good level of ruggedness for everyday demanding use, combined with the familiarity of Android.
Samsung Galaxy Tab Active4 Pro: This tablet offers a balance of durability and modern features. While it often uses Qualcomm Snapdragon processors rather than Intel or AMD high-performance chips, it’s powerful enough for lighter video editing tasks on the go. Key features include MIL-STD-810H compliance, IP68 water and dust resistance, and a removable battery. Crucially, it has 6GB or 8GB of RAM and options for significant internal storage (often 128GB or 256GB, expandable via microSD).
Pros: More affordable than many Windows-based rugged tablets; good for lighter edits and mobile workflows; familiar Android OS; decent battery life.
Cons: Not designed for intensive, professional-grade editing; processor power is lower than rugged Windows laptops/tablets; screen might not be ideal for critical color grading.
Ruggedized Laptops with Tablet Modes
Some ruggedized laptops, often called 2-in-1s or convertibles, can function as rugged tablets with their screens flipped or detached. These often offer the highest performance ceilings.
Dell Latitude Rugged Extreme Series: While primarily rugged laptops, some convertibles within this line can be used in a tablet mode. They offer very high-end Intel Core processors, up to 64GB RAM, and 1TB+ SSDs, along with extreme durability.
Pros: Top-tier performance options; exceptional ruggedness; versatile.
Cons: Very expensive; bulky and heavy in tablet mode.
Rugged Tablet vs. Standard Tablet for Video Editing: The Trade-offs

Choosing a rugged tablet isn’t just about adding durability; it comes with specific trade-offs compared to a standard consumer tablet.
Advantages of Rugged Tablets:
Extreme Durability: They can handle drops, shocks, vibrations, extreme temperatures, dust, and water immersion – essential for field work.
Outdoor Usability: Often feature very bright, sunlight-readable displays.
Longer Battery Life: Designed for extended use in remote locations.
Specialized Connectivity: May include options like serial ports or more robust cellular modems.
Professional-Grade Build: Built for reliability in harsh environments, which can translate to fewer hardware failures.
Disadvantages of Rugged Tablets:
Price: Significantly more expensive than comparable consumer tablets due to their specialized construction.
Weight and Bulk: They are heavier and thicker to accommodate their protective features.
Performance Limitations: While some are powerful, they might not reach the bleeding edge of performance found in high-end consumer ultrabooks or specialized mobile workstations.
Aesthetics: They typically have a utilitarian design, not the sleeker look of consumer devices.
Display Quality: Color accuracy and vibrancy might be secondary to sunlight readability and durability in some models.

Considerations for Field Video Production Workflows
If you’re looking at rugged tablets, chances are you’re working in demanding conditions. Here are a few workflow tips:
Proxy Editing: For smoother playback and editing on less powerful devices, create “proxies.” These are lower-resolution versions of your footage that your editing software uses during the editing process. You then replace them with the original high-resolution files for final export.
External Storage: Video files take up a lot of space. Use fast external SSDs connected via USB-C or USB-A. Ensure your tablet’s USB ports support high transfer speeds (USB 3.0/3.1/3.2 or Thunderbolt).
Card Readers: Invest in a high-quality, fast SD card reader that plugs directly into your tablet.
Power Management: Always carry a reliable power bank or ensure your tablet has a large, long-lasting battery. Hot-swappable batteries on some Panasonic and Getac models are incredibly useful if you can’t afford downtime.
Cloud Sync: Utilize cloud storage services (like Dropbox, Google Drive, OneDrive) to back up footage or transfer files to your main editing station. A strong cellular connection or reliable Wi-Fi is key here.
